                                Master Builders - 2009 National Award Winners
         Statement by Mr Wilhelm Harnisch, Chief Executive Officer
Builders from across Australia were presented with prestigious Awards at Master Builders' 2009 National Excellence in Building and Construction Awards at Conrad Jupiters on the Gold Coast on Saturday 7 November.
Master Builders Chief Executive, Mr Wilhelm Harnisch, congratulated the winners saying that they "demonstrated that they are the best of the best by delivering the highest quality of work in their projects, thereby setting a standard for the rest of industry to aspire to."
